The Alternate Title Specialist investigates titling issues using decision making and problem-solving skills to move vehicles through the pipeline to Auction. This involves networking across the country with our field operations for best practices and processes, staying up-to-date with legislative changes impacting the vehicle titling industry, and utilizing virtual multi-platform databases including government DMV/BMV third party sites. Responsibilities: · Utilize decision making and problem-solving skills to free up aged insurance claim vehicle inventory. · Troubleshooting and problem resolution specific to vehicle titles; odometer discrepancies, power of attorney, etc. · Ability to understand and apply all DMV laws, rules and regulations concerning insurance claim vehicles. · Efficiently and accurately identify/analyze/process ownership documents within company and state alternate special transfer guidelines. · Performs administrative duties in the office such as data entry, follow-ups, reports, and word processing associated with Copart documentation and services. Required Skills and Experience: HS diploma or GED preferred. Minimum of one year of office support experience in a customer service/sales role. Experience with title processing a plus. Previous customer service experience. Ability to work well independently & as a team player to achieve goals. Professional phone etiquette. Must possess excellent time-management & organizational skills. Possess a strong work ethic and decision-making skills. Excellent customer service attitude and skills. Excellent communication skills. Computer proficiency (Microsoft Office products, primarily Excel and Outlook) Must be able to multi-task in a fast-paced environment. Strong attention to detail; checks and balances.
